A BILL FOR AN ACT
relating to tourism.
B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F HAWAII:
SECTION 1. No later than December 31, 2012, all signs currently identifying state landmarks, as determined by the state and the Hawaii Visitors and Conventions Bureau, shall be replaced with signs that convey interpretive information.
For purposes of this Act, "signs that convey interpretive information" means signage erected to provide information to the public on the environmental, historic, cultural, or other values of a building, site, or landmark.
SECTION 2. This Act shall take effect upon its approval.
